[09-04-2026] Riverside County, CA – Student Injured in Hit-and-Run Crash on Victoria and Myrtle Ave.

[09-04-2026] Riverside County, CA – Student Injured in Hit-and-Run Crash on Victoria and Myrtle Ave.webpA Riverside Poly High School student was injured in a hit-and-run crash in Riverside on Friday afternoon, September 4, 2026.

According to the Riverside Police Department, the incident occurred around 3:40 p.m. near the intersection of Victoria and Myrtle avenues. Police said multiple callers reported that a vehicle struck the student before leaving the scene.

The student, whose identity has not been released, was transported to a nearby hospital for treatment. Police said the student remained hospitalized a week after the crash but was in stable condition.

Detectives used information provided by the public and data from automated license plate readers to identify a suspect and the involved vehicle. Officers later located the unoccupied vehicle and impounded it as evidence.

Police identified the suspect only as a 47-year-old Bloomington man. After detectives contacted him, authorities said he turned himself in on Thursday, September 10.

The man was arrested and booked on suspicion of felony hit-and-run. Police have not publicly released his identity.

The investigation is ongoing.
